Republic of the Congo - Cassava Losses
Since 2014, Republic of the Congo Cassava Losses grew 1.2% year on year. At 108 Thousand Metric Tons in 2019, the country was number 23 comparing other countries in Cassava Losses. Republic of the Congo is overtaken by China, which was ranked number 22 at 148 Thousand Metric Tons and is followed by Guinea with 105 Thousand Metric Tons. Ghana topped the ranking with 6,133 Thousand Metric Tons in 2019, a decrease of 1.9% compared to 2018. Nigeria, Thailand and Cameroon resp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Niger witnessed the best average annual growth at +27.7% per year, while Fiji was the worst growing country at -12.9% per year.
